AI Technical Summary

Technical Problem

Existing tablet forming equipment makes it difficult to easily remove the formed tablets, which can easily cause spillage. Furthermore, it cannot flexibly change the mold, affecting cleanliness and production efficiency.

Method used

A tablet production device was designed, comprising a chassis frame, a main control console, a mold plate limiting groove, a drive motor, and an extrusion connecting rod. The main controller controls the drive motor to adjust the height of the extrusion connecting rod, thereby realizing the extrusion molding and collection of tablets. The mold plate is detachably installed in the limiting groove, and the stability and accuracy of the mold are ensured by using buckles and limiting blocks.

Benefits of technology

This technology enables convenient collection of tablets and stable installation of molds, improving production efficiency and cleanliness, and ensuring the precision of tablet forming.

Abstract

The utility model discloses tablet production equipment, which relates to the technical field of tablet production and comprises a chassis frame, a master console is fixedly mounted at the top end of one side of the chassis frame, a master controller is fixedly mounted on the front side of one side of the master console, and a mold plate limiting groove is formed in the surface of the top end of one side of the chassis frame. A mold disc is directly installed in a mold disc limiting groove, a master controller on a master console directly controls starting operation of a driving motor, the driving motor directly controls stretching and retracting of an extrusion connecting rod to adjust the height, a tablet pressing disc is used for directly extruding the interior of the mold disc, and a proper amount of materials are placed in the mold disc; and after tabletting is achieved through the mold disc, tablets are collected through the tablet collecting box, then the tablet collecting box is directly pulled out from the interior of the base plate frame through a box body disassembly auxiliary handle, concentrated material taking operation is facilitated, and the material production efficiency of the device is improved.

TECHNICAL FIELD

[0001] The utility model relates to tablet production technical field especially, relate to a tablet production equipment. BACKGROUND

[0002] The most common in the processing and production process of medicinal materials is to press powder or semi-finished granular material into western medicine tablets, traditional Chinese medicine tablets or disinfection tablets, and the tablet production machine is a machine for pressing powder and granular material into tablet-shaped medicine, at present, the existing tablet machine for tablet forming is inconvenient to take out the formed tablets, and it is difficult to prevent the powder from spilling when loading, and only single size tablets can be produced, which reduces the overall production of the device, cannot directly replace and clean the mold, and also affects the cleaning degree in the production process, therefore, we redesign a tablet production equipment. [0026] Working principle:

[0027] By setting the mold disc 5 directly mounted to the inside of the mold disc limiting groove 4, the main controller 3 on the main console 2 directly controls the opening operation of the drive motor 7, the drive motor 7 directly controls the extension adjustment height of the extrusion connecting rod 10, the tablet pressing disc 11 is directly extruded into the inside of the mold disc 5, the appropriate amount of material is put into the inside of the mold disc 5, the extrusion tablet pressing production effect is realized between the tablet pressing disc 11 and the mold disc 5, after the tablet pressing of the mold disc 5 is realized, the tablet collecting box 12 is used to collect the tablets, the tablet collecting box 12 is directly taken out from the inside of the bottom tray frame 1 by using the box body disassembly auxiliary handle 13, the centralized material taking operation is facilitated, and the material production efficiency of the device is improved;

[0028] By setting the tablet pressing grooves 16 of multiple positions on the inside surface of the mold disc 5, the extrusion tablet pressing operation is realized, the isolation plate 19 is arranged on the bottom end surface of the mold disc 5, the bottom end surface of the mold disc 5 can be sealed, the extrusion connecting rod 10 can be directly disassembled during tablet pressing, the mold disc 5 is mounted to the inside of the mold disc limiting groove 4, the installation between the buckle mounting groove 25 and the bolt limiting block 17 is realized, the rotating shaft 22 rotates on the mounting column 20 to adjust the position of the buckle limiting plate 23, the buckle limiting plate 23 is directly buckled into the inside of the fixed buckle disc 24, the side surface of the mold disc 5 is limited and buckled by the buckle limiting plate 23, the installation stability of the mold disc 5 is ensured, and the tablet pressing precision of the mold disc 5 is ensured.
